"Ἐπιπολαί" meaning in Ancient Greek

See Ἐπιπολαί in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Proper name

IPA: /e.pi.po.lǎi̯/, /e.pi.poˈlɛ/, /e.pi.poˈle/, /e.pi.po.lǎi̯/ (note: 5ᵗʰ BCE Attic), /e.pi.poˈlɛ/ (note: 1ˢᵗ CE Egyptian), /e.pi.poˈlɛ/ (note: 4ᵗʰ CE Koine), /e.pi.poˈle/ (note: 10ᵗʰ CE Byzantine), /e.pi.poˈle/ (note: 15ᵗʰ CE Constantinopolitan)
Head templates: {{grc-proper noun|Ἐπῐπολῶν|m|first|head=Ἐπῐπολαί}} Ἐπῐπολαί • (Epĭpolaí) m (genitive Ἐπῐπολῶν); first declension Inflection templates: {{grc-decl|Ἐπῐπολή|ης|form=plur}} Forms: Ἐπῐπολαί [canonical], Epĭpolaí [romanization], Ἐπῐπολῶν [genitive], Attic declension-1 [table-tags], αἱ Ἐπῐπολαί [nominative, plural], τῶν Ἐπῐπολῶν [genitive, plural], ταῖς Ἐπῐπολαῖς [dative, plural], τᾱ̀ς Ἐπῐπολᾱ́ς [accusative, plural], Ἐπῐπολαί [plural, vocative]
  1. Epipolae (a strategically important plateau in Sicily, location of the Euryalus fortress)
